Satura rādītājs:

Ne tik pamata partijas apmācība: 6 soļi
Ne tik pamata partijas apmācība: 6 soļi

Video: Ne tik pamata partijas apmācība: 6 soļi

Video: Ne tik pamata partijas apmācība: 6 soļi
Video: Страшные истории. ЗАПЕРТАЯ КОМНАТА. Деревенские страшилки. Ужасы. Мистика. 2024, Novembris
Anonim
Ne tik pamata partijas apmācība
Ne tik pamata partijas apmācība

Iepriekšējā apmācībā mēs iemācījāmies sērijveida failu rakstīšanas pamatlietas. Ja jums nav ne jausmas, kas ir partija, bet vēlaties to iemācīties, skatiet sadaļu "Ļoti vienkārša partijas apmācība". Šajā apmācībā jūs uzzināsit sarežģītākas komandas un to, kā izmantot tos, lai izveidotu lietojumprogrammu.

1. darbība: mainīgie Step (1/3)

Mainīgie ir lietas, kas mainās. Izveidojot mainīgo, mēs izveidojam kaut ko tādu, ko vēlamies, lai dators mums atcerētos, ko mēs varam izmantot vēlāk programmā; mēs piešķiram datoram vērtību, kuru mēs vēlamies saglabāt un mēs piešķiram tai etiķeti, kurā to uzglabāt. mēs varam izveidot veselus skaitļus un virknes, izmantojot mainīgos. Lai izveidotu mainīgo, jums jāiemācās SET komanda. SET komanda ir tā, kas rada mainīgos; SET name = value Ievadiet savu CMD šādi: SET name = hello'name 'ir mainīgā nosaukums, un' hello 'ir tas, ko mainīgais saglabā, tāpēc tagad, katru reizi ierakstot "echo name", jāpasaka "hello" yes? NO Ja vēlaties parādīt mainīgo, ielieciet ap to procentuālās (%) zīmes. Tātad, ja jūs ierakstāt "echo%test%" un tam vajadzētu pateikt "sveiki" jā? JĀ

2. darbība: mainīgie Step (2/3)

Mainīgo solis (2/3)
Mainīgo solis (2/3)

Tātad tagad mēs noteikti varam veikt matemātiku? Mēs ierakstām num = 1 Tādējādi tiek izveidots mainīgais ar nosaukumu "num", kuram pievienota vērtība 1. un padariet to par num+1 (aka 1+1)) thenecho %num %tam vajadzētu dot mums 2, vai ne? Izmēģināsim to: piezīmju grāmatiņā ierakstiet šādu un saglabājiet kā MathAttempt.bat (neiekļaujiet zvaigznītes (*)) @echo offset v = 1set v =%v%+1echo%v%pauseit vajadzētu teikt 2, jā? NOPE. tas saka 1+1, jo dators jūsu komandu interpretē šādi: jūs: "so num = 1, right?" pc: "pareizi" tu: "kas tad ir skaitlis plus viens?" pc: num+1 = 1+1tad dators tavu komandu interpretē burtiski.

3. darbība: mainīgie Step (3/3)

Mainīgie Step (3/3)
Mainīgie Step (3/3)

Tātad, kā panākt, lai dators domātu matemātiski? Vienkārši, pirms mainīgā nosaukuma mēs pievienojam /a %num% , tad mums vajadzētu iegūt 2, vai ne? Izmēģināsim to. Ierakstiet to piezīmju grāmatiņā…. bla bla bla, jūs zināt šo urbumu. ******************** ******************************@echo offset /a num = 1set /a num =%num%+1echo%num% pauze ************************************************ *** tur! tas pievienoja 1+1! dators to redz: _you: so num = 1, right? pc: rightyou: tātad, kas ir num plus viens? pc: num+1 = 1+1 = 2Voila! Tātad, tagad ļaujim izveidot skaitīšanas programma! mēs izmantosim komandu goto, par kuru uzzinājām ļoti pamata partijas apmācībā. **************************** ****************************@echo offset /a num = 1: topset /a num =%num%+1echo%num% goto top ************************************************ ********** Dators pievieno 1, tad dodas uz augšu un atkal pievieno 1 utt.

4. darbība. Parametri Solis (1/2)

Parametru solis (1/2)
Parametru solis (1/2)

Tātad, tagad, kad mēs varam izmantot mainīgos, ko darīt, ja mums ir izvēles iespējas, piemēram: nospiediet 1, lai pateiktu sveiki. Nospiediet 2, lai atvadītos. Mēs izmantojam komandu "IF", piemēram: Ierakstiet šo savā CMD: ja 1 = = 1 atbalss Redzēt, ka tas darbojas! (==) nozīmē "ir vienāds ar", jūs varētu arī ierakstīt "EQU") Mēs saņēmām ziņojumu, kurā teikts: "Redziet, ka tas darbojas!" Tagad ierakstiet šo: ja 1 == 2 echo It Works! Mēs neko neredzējām, jo 1 nav vienāds ar 2 gaidīs, kad jūs kaut ko ievietosit. tāpēc mēs ierakstām: ************************************* *@echo offset v1 = hi !! set v2 = bye !! echo Nospiediet 1, lai pateiktu HI! echo Nospiediet 2, lai teiktu BYE! set /p you = ja %jūs %== 1 echo %v1 %, ja %jūs %= = 2 atbalss %v2 %pauze ************************************* Tas stāsta datoram ka, ja mēs ierakstām 1, tam jāatbalsta HI !, un, ja mēs sakām 2, tam jāatbalstās BYE !!

5. darbība: parametri Solis (2/2)

Parametru solis (2/2)
Parametru solis (2/2)

Tātad, tagad mēs zinām, ka, ja mēs vēlamies izvēlēties mainīgo, mēs ierakstām: set /p variablename = un ja mēs vēlamies iestatīt mainīgo, mēs ierakstām: set /a variablename = value 2000? Šajā programmā mēs izmantosim SET, IF un GOTO (un, protams, atbalsi) ******************************* *****@echo offset /a num = 0: topset /a num =%num%+1echo%num%, ja%num%== 2000 goto gobackgoto top: gobackset /a num =%num%-1echo%num %ja %num %== 0 goto topgoto goback ************************************* Tātad tagad, kad tas sasniedz 2000. gadu, IF komanda padara to par GOTO otro daļu, kas ļauj to atskaitīt, tad, kad tas sasniedz 0, tā GOTO pirmo daļu, kas liek to saskaitīt … utt utt utt

6. darbība. Gatavs

Jūs esat pabeidzis manu partiju apmācības. Jūs varat doties šeit, lai dotos uz citu pamācību dažām Cool Batch lietojumprogrammām Es centīšos jums palīdzēt. Ja vēlaties izmēģināt kaut ko bezsaistē, iesaku apgūt sērijveida programmēšanu! autors Džons Alberts, patiešām vienkāršs, viegli sekojams un lielisks, ja vēlaties kļūt labāks!

Ieteicams: